Output b4e7df831030eacdb151412c4c2e95c7a4dfaba87486126dfe857a1dfc7d8586:1

value
19939578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9687475a2f43dbb49ed5baffe4a7f959b9a666c OP_EQUAL
address
3H8mFconECuB9xM71L7hshtnps4Z61kM6E
transaction
b4e7df831030eacdb151412c4c2e95c7a4dfaba87486126dfe857a1dfc7d8586
confirmations
377589
spent
true